Subject: [PATCH] i2c-at91: fix data-loss issue
Date: Sat, 14 Apr 2012 08:06:13 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<4F88A355.2060303@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1334317476-10044-1-git-send-email-h.feurstein@gmail.com>

On 13/04/12 21:44, Hubert Feurstein wrote:

> In the interrupt handler both status-flags (TXCOMP and RXRDY) might be
> pending at the same time. In this case TXCOMP is handled but NOT RXRDY
> which causes a data-loss on the current transfer. As a consequence also the
> next transfer will be corrupt, because old data is pending in RHR.
> 
> To make sure that we do not start with old data in any case, SR and RHR is
> read empty before initiating a new transfer.

> diff --git a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91.c b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91.c
> index 40c39a2..295835f 100644
> --- a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91.c
> +++ b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91.c
> @@ -161,18 +161,22 @@ static irqreturn_t atmel_twi_interrupt(int irq, void *dev_id)
>  {
>  	struct at91_twi_dev *dev = dev_id;
>  	const unsigned status = at91_twi_read(dev, AT91_TWI_SR);
> -	const unsigned irqstatus = status & at91_twi_read(dev, AT91_TWI_IMR);
> +	unsigned irqstatus = status & at91_twi_read(dev, AT91_TWI_IMR);
> +
> +	irqstatus &= (AT91_TWI_RXRDY | AT91_TWI_TXRDY | AT91_TWI_TXCOMP);

> +	if (!irqstatus)
> +		return IRQ_NONE;
> +
> +	if (irqstatus & AT91_TWI_RXRDY)
> +		at91_twi_read_next_byte(dev);
> +
> +	if (irqstatus & AT91_TWI_TXRDY)
> +		at91_twi_write_next_byte(dev);
>  
>  	if (irqstatus & AT91_TWI_TXCOMP) {
>  		at91_disable_twi_interrupts(dev);
>  		dev->transfer_status = status;
>  		complete(&dev->cmd_complete);
> -	} else if (irqstatus & AT91_TWI_RXRDY) {
> -		at91_twi_read_next_byte(dev);
> -	} else if (irqstatus & AT91_TWI_TXRDY) {
> -		at91_twi_write_next_byte(dev);
> -	} else {
> -		return IRQ_NONE;
>  	}
>  
>  	return IRQ_HANDLED;
> @@ -189,6 +193,10 @@ static int at91_do_twi_transfer(struct at91_twi_dev *dev)
>  	if (dev->msg->flags & I2C_M_RD) {
>  		unsigned start_flags = AT91_TWI_START;
>  
> +		/* clear any pending data */
> +		(void)at91_twi_read(dev, AT91_TWI_SR);
> +		(void)at91_twi_read(dev, AT91_TWI_RHR);


Drop the void cast.

> +
>  		/* if only one byte is to be read, immediately stop transfer */
>  		if (dev->buf_len <= 1 && !(dev->msg->flags & I2C_M_RECV_LEN))
>  			start_flags |= AT91_TWI_STOP;
> @@ -259,6 +267,7 @@ static int at91_twi_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, struct i2c_msg *msg, int num)
>  			internal_address |= addr << (8 * i);
>  			int_addr_flag += AT91_TWI_IADRSZ_1;
>  		}
> +


Please don't make unrelated whitespace changes.

>  		at91_twi_write(dev, AT91_TWI_IADR, internal_address);
>  	}
>  


With those fixed, please add:

Reviewed-by: Ryan Mallon <rmallon@gmail.com>
